“I am the Senior Sister for outpatient services at both Scarborough and Bridlington hospitals, having started my career as a student nurse in 1977.

"My mother was a nurse and worked for many years in a GP practice in Bridlington, so I knew from a young age I also wanted to make a difference to people’s lives and felt that nursing was the best way to do this.

"Every day I get to meet some wonderful patients, carers and families - and I am also blessed to be working with two wonderful teams of highly skilled staff nurses and HCA’s who strive, day in and day out, to deliver the best care they can.

"The best bit of advice I have been given is always try to do the best for patients and colleagues and they will respect you for your efforts.  I like to think this is true.

"I will retire later this year but I will look back on my career with pride and fulfilment knowing I helped make a difference to the many patients I have cared for over the years.”
